Florencia Di Stefano Abichain is an Italian-Argentine translator, content creator, radio presenter, and podcaster who was born in a multicultural setting. She began her career as a digital manager working for several major brands before making the leap to become a content creator for TV and the web.
She is also an author, writer, speaker, and radio presenter, and creates podcasts for a variety of programs and magazines. Between all this, she still finds time to run events and collaborate as a public speaker. In 2020, she won a Diversity Media Award for the best radio program of the year with Ordinary Girls on Radio Popolare. The following year, she was named the Argentine Person of the Year by the Consulate of Argentina in Italy and Argentina's Ministry of Culture.
